The Delhi Police have successfully apprehended Akash, an alleged gangster and proclaimed offender, from Haryana's Faridabad, according to official reports on Tuesday.

Akash, whose criminal activities include murder and robbery, was a fugitive since a city court declared him a proclaimed offender on March 9. Despite concerted efforts by law enforcement, he managed to evade capture until a decisive raid in Old Faridabad on April 19 led to his arrest.

During interrogation, Akash admitted his involvement in numerous criminal acts across 14 different cases, such as offenses under the NDPS Act and the Arms Act. Authorities continue to investigate the extent of his criminal undertakings.
